Scholarships

  • Cedar Crest Scholarships Information
  • Cedar Crest Scholarships
  • Presidential Scholarship: $15,000 per year, 3.5 -4.0 cumulative GPA
    Trustee Scholarship:  $13,000 per year, 3.3 – 3.49 cumulative GPA
    Founders Scholarship:  $10,000 per year, 3.0 – 3.29 cumulative GPA

    Awarded to full-time transfer students based on their cumulative transfer GPA from all transfer institutions. The Presidential, Trustee, and Founders Scholarships are automatically renewed each year provided the student maintains a 2.5 cumulative GPA and retains a full-time student status.

    Honors Transfer Community College Scholarship:  $18,000 annually

    • must complete an on-campus interview
    • must have 3.5 GPA/24 credits
    • only 15 students from each community college will be selected for this scholarship

    Honors Transfer Community College Scholarship is awarded to full-time transfer students and cannot be combined with any other merit scholarship.  Honors Transfer Community College Scholarship is automatically renewed each year provided the student maintains a 3.5 cumulative GPA and retains a full-time student status. (Honors students can transfer directly into the Cedar Crest College Honors Program.)

Agreement/Transfer Information

Core-to-Core Agreement

Completion of an AA, AFA, AS degree will result in all of Cedar Crest College's Core requirements having been met.

Honors-to-Honors Agreement

Student graduating from Bucks' Honors program will be automatically accepted in the Honors program at Cedar Crest College.

Dual Admissions

Students may apply to be conditionally accepted to Cedar Crest College under the terms of the Dual Admission Agreement‌. To be eligible for the Dual Admissions program, students must:

  • Submit the Dual Admissions Intent Form by the time they complete 30 college-level credits to include those credits from other universities or colleges.
  • Earn an associate degree with a minimum final GPA of 2.0 at the time of graduation from Bucks to include the GPA form other universities and colleges attended.
  • Enroll at Cedar Crest College within one year of graduation from Bucks.
  • Do not attend another institution between graduation from Bucks and enrollment at Cedar Crest College.

Students who are part of Cedar Crest Dual Admissions have the following advantages:

  • Application fee is waived.
  • Academic scholarship opportunities are available to Dual Admissions students.  (See scholarship section of this page)
  • Have a special Cedar Crest sticker affixed to the Bucks ID which will allow free or reduced cost admission to select events.
